"""functional/non regression tests for pylint"""
import contextlib
import functools
import tokenize
from io import StringIO

from pylint.testutils.global_test_linter import linter
from pylint.testutils.output_line import Message
from pylint.utils import ASTWalker


class UnittestLinter:
    """A fake linter class to capture checker messages."""

    # pylint: disable=unused-argument, no-self-use

    def __init__(self):
        self._messages = []
        self.stats = {}

    def release_messages(self):
        try:
            return self._messages
        finally:
            self._messages = []

    def add_message(
        self, msg_id, line=None, node=None, args=None, confidence=None, col_offset=None
    ):
        # Do not test col_offset for now since changing Message breaks everything
        self._messages.append(Message(msg_id, line, node, args, confidence))

    @staticmethod
    def is_message_enabled(*unused_args, **unused_kwargs):
        return True

    def add_stats(self, **kwargs):
        for name, value in kwargs.items():
            self.stats[name] = value
        return self.stats

    @property
    def options_providers(self):
        return linter.options_providers


def set_config(**kwargs):
    """Decorator for setting config values on a checker."""

    def _wrapper(fun):
        @functools.wraps(fun)
        def _forward(self):
            for key, value in kwargs.items():
                setattr(self.checker.config, key, value)
            if isinstance(self, CheckerTestCase):
                # reopen checker in case, it may be interested in configuration change
                self.checker.open()
            fun(self)

        return _forward

    return _wrapper


class CheckerTestCase:
    """A base testcase class for unit testing individual checker classes."""

    CHECKER_CLASS = None
    CONFIG = {}

    def setup_method(self):
        self.linter = UnittestLinter()
        self.checker = self.CHECKER_CLASS(self.linter)  # pylint: disable=not-callable
        for key, value in self.CONFIG.items():
            setattr(self.checker.config, key, value)
        self.checker.open()

    @contextlib.contextmanager
    def assertNoMessages(self):
        """Assert that no messages are added by the given method."""
        with self.assertAddsMessages():
            yield

    @contextlib.contextmanager
    def assertAddsMessages(self, *messages):
        """Assert that exactly the given method adds the given messages.

        The list of messages must exactly match *all* the messages added by the
        method. Additionally, we check to see whether the args in each message can
        actually be substituted into the message string.
        """
        yield
        got = self.linter.release_messages()
        msg = "Expected messages did not match actual.\n" "Expected:\n%s\nGot:\n%s" % (
            "\n".join(repr(m) for m in messages),
            "\n".join(repr(m) for m in got),
        )
        assert list(messages) == got, msg

    def walk(self, node):
        """recursive walk on the given node"""
        walker = ASTWalker(linter)
        walker.add_checker(self.checker)
        walker.walk(node)


def _tokenize_str(code):
    return list(tokenize.generate_tokens(StringIO(code).readline))
